You will be joining a fast paced and rapidly growing company, your ability to hit the ground running and being able to work on your own initiative is necessary.
The successful candidate will have experience with:
- Experience as a Bench Hand Joiner/Cabinet Maker
- Knowledge and experience of manufacturing joinery
- Knowledge and understanding of health and safety
- Knowledge of different woodworking tools and machinery as well as hand and power tools
- A meticulous and organised nature
- Must be confident consulting with suppliers and co-workers
- Reading drawings and interpreting accurately
